A big hello to all my old skiing pals on this site. Well today I went up to the mountain and wanted to see how the old muscle memory worked. Had surgery on my second hip 6/2010 but like my other one, I waited the full year before getting back on the boards. Both hips performed perfectly. The mountain has only been opened on weekends but today it opened 7 days a week. We had a nice storm earlier this week so today's opening produced unskied "over the top boot" deep pow, cold,light and fluffy. Took me one run to feel normal and then headed for the good stuff. Wow, both hips worked great. More of the mountain should open this week and will have to make another video showing that Bi-Lats can rip with the best...LOL
For all those Hippys who just got surgery or are thinking of getting the procedure, don't hesitate. Even with two resurfaced hips, skiing is as good as ever. Yippppeeeee.  Best to all, Shelly
